Batman would have been around for a little over three years, at this point, so very little is still known about him. The mob was pretty much run out of town (to set up the rise of the "freaks" and such), save for the Falcones and the Maronis, whose numbers are dwindling by the day. Street crime and gangs are the most prevalent source of Gotham's misery, save for the activities of The Penguin. Wayne Enterprises is pretty much as it is in the comics - a well-known industrial giant with more than a few side divisions. Arkham Asylum is on an island similar to The Narrows from Batman Begins, minus the whole "everyone's broken out" part. Blackgate Island is on the other side. Harvey Dent's the current DA and I'll be bringing in a new police Commissioner as Gordon's superior within the first few posts. The Joker's really the only supervillain Bats has dealt with so far.
That's pretty much all I've got. Anything else, you're free to interpret as much as you want.
